Installation Instructions WINDOW INSTALLATIONmOPTIONAL (cont.) [] INSTALL CASE IN WINDOW [] Peel off the backing from the bottom window gasket. ['B] Place the gasket on the stool and over the brackets, even with the rear edge, sticky side down. [] With the window closed, mark where the window sash meets the case. [] Peel off the backing from the case top gasket. [] Hold on to the case, open the window, and place the gasket along the mark on the case. Put the gasket on top of the case where the window will close. J..L..2...... t t "I Bottom window gasket [] Carefully slide the empty case into the window until the holes in the case line up with the holes in the panel angles. Case holes [] Place the vinyl window gasket over the case top gasket. Insert the panel tabs through the slits in the gasket. Cut the gasket on each side to the width of the window. _ T NOTES: • The case should have a 1/8" minimum tilt toward the outside. • Be sure the seal gasket and panel gaskets remain in position and do not roll with the case. [] Lower the window so it fits behind the panel tabs. Insert the 4 type A screws through the holes in the case and into the panel angles, 2 on each side. Panel_ tabs °_*'_ Case [ tab Vinyl window gasket [] Close the window tightly on the vinyl gasket. Bend the gasket forward to expose the panel tabs. Drill pilot holes into the window sash. the panel tab to the window on each side with a type U screw. 20
